Electoral commission recommends youth elections, says it give hopes for 2026 National Election

South Sudan National Elections Commission (NEC) Chairperson prof Abednego Akok Kacuol appreciated youth Organizations adding that their level give hope for the upcoming country’s election in 2026.

South Sudan Election continue to delay due to disagreement between peace parties however hope has been placed in 2026, for election to occur.

While presiding over Twic East Youth Association (TEYA)campaigns for election 2025-2027 in Juba, Commissioner Akok appreciated the process and level of preparation.

Twic East Youth Association (TEYA) is wing of Twic Community Association in Juba, Association made up of community members from Twic East County of Jonglei state.

The election campaign that took place on Saturday with subsequent election on Sunday brought thousand of participates to take part at Gumbo Shirakat, a resident area in Juba.

While candidature is base on alliance base with maximum of five groups ready to compete for the leadership for 2025-2026, a two-year term.

In his address, prof Abednego Akok the Chairperson of National Elections Commission (NEC) appreciated the youth election committee adding that their level of preparation gives hope for 2026 election.

“When i come for youth election like this TEYA Campaign, ifeel Honor because they are organized well and these give hope in our upcoming National Election in 2026” Akok said

“Youth are organizing election in counties and when election come, they will elect their leaders without problem and it give hope, it is part of civic education” he said.

He appreciated the youth election committee and urged the other youth groups to imitate the same.

“I am very happy and ask God to keep people health to ensure that 2026 election is successful, i appreciated TEYA independent electoral committee for these beautiful election preparation” he said
NEC chairperson urged the contestants to later own accept the results of the election and ensure that the support one another.

Dr. Akech Awan Adit the Chairman of TEYA Independent Electors Committee, 2025-2027 Juba South Sudan vowed to ensure that the elections are transparent and fair.

He called on the candidates to accept defeat after election adding that the seat is one an could not accommodate all of them.

On his part Arok Dut Arok the Chairperson of Twic East Youth Association (TEYA) appreciated the committed for their commitment toward successful election preparation.

He appealed to the candidates for their continuous health campaigns and urged to accept defeat after election.
